Yeah, life’s been a bit crazy. But somehow, in the past few months, you know, in between baseball games, late at night or in those spare minutes here and there, I illustrated and published a coloring book.

It’s called Hello Sunshine, and despite being my own harshest critic, I am super pumped with how this beauty turned out. I even gave myself a pat on the back.

It’s 120 pages and features over 50 hand-drawn illustrations that are a joy to color in. Some are simple, some are a bit more complex, but one thing you won’t find in this bad boy is any clip art or AI generated crap just meant to fill pages. Some pages you might actually want to tear out and frame. Or, I’m thinking if you color in every page, then tear out every page, it could be a SWEET collage wall  (If anyone does that please send me pics.)

It’s a labor of love that provided a hefty load of mental relief, and I hope you’ll love coloring this thing in as much as I loved drawing it all.
